I'll say this about my dealing with Kevin aka Tattooball.
I was fortunate enough to get one of the first production Nightmare bats. When I got the bat I told Kevin that after the break in process I would make a video review.
Kevin told me the following.... if you roll the bat it will break right away and whatever your opinion of the bat is, be 100% honest. Good or bad. He insisted that I be totally honest in my review even if I hated the bat. What I learned about the Nightmare is that it is a stiff feeling bat that performs very well even when it "feels" like you missed the "sweet spot". I am definitely a bat breaker. Bats that don't break right away like the Legit will get too soft to perform for me. My Nightmare lasted me 1100 very happy swings. An Ultra 2 pc 200, Reebok 275, Legit 300 too soft. Is the Nightmare for everyone? No way. Some people won't be able to handle the big end load. Some won't like the stiff feel. Some people simply won't like Kevin LOL. The Blue Flame I am using is about 3 years old.
It is extremely adjustable and is currently set to throw a 12' arc. As its names implies [UPM45] it pitches to 45 mph. The Black Flame machine UPM60 throws up to 60mph.
You can quite easily dial in whatever arc you want and it is very consistent. The only variable being the weight of each ball.

One thing not mentioned in this discussion is playing conditions and how much easier it is to hit the home runs at altitude. Dry conditions and altitude add up to huge home run numbers. In the southeast, with heat indexes in triple digits and high humidity it is a little more difficult. While for some of us it is still pretty easy, for most it is not. As far as USSSA goes the major division limit is 16 and the A division is 12. If you want to insist on run limits and home run limits the current number needs to be higher in Plus. I think maybe the problem is trying to make the rules equal with vastly different playing conditions across the country.

5.5(3) • MERCY RULE FOR 50+ THRU 70+ MAJOR-PLUS (ONLY)
If a team is ahead by 15 or more runs at any time after five innings have
been completed, or four and one-half innings with the home team ahead,
the game shall be declared a complete regulation game.

AT ANY TIME would mean that the visitors ahead by 15 in the top of the 6th...... game over. MAKES NO SENSE.

5.4(2) • INTERNATIONAL TIE-BREAKER RULE
Teams start each half-inning with a runner on second base. The runner is the
last batter of the previous inning whose turn at bat had been completed,
assuming a position on second base. No substitute or courtesy runner may
replace him until he has reached third base. EFFECT: If the last batter of the
previous inning cannot continue to play because of injury, illness, etc., he will
be declared out and the next previous batter will be the tie-breaker runner.

If the open inning ends in a tie..... are the extra innings open or subject to the 5/7 run limit? The rule states that the last inning of the game is open. Does that rule carry over to extra innings?

Senior Softball-USA is dedicated to informing and uniting the Senior Softball Players of America and the World. Senior Softball-USA sanctions tournaments and championships, registers players, writes the rulebook, publishes Senior Softball-USA News, hosts international softball tours and promotes Senior Softball throughout the world. More than 1.5 million men and women over 40 play Senior Softball in the United States today. »SSUSA History  »Privacy policy
